Crazy shipping in bad weather videos2/11/2023 It’s also recommended that lorries are equipped with a lightweight shovel and towrope and, where possible, a bag of road salt or grit to assist with traction. This can vary depending on the exact type of adverse weather but can include, for example, ensuring that tyres are in good condition with a sufficient tread depth in wintry conditions, and that tyre pressure is regularly checked and maintained. In amber alerts, for example, drivers are advised to be mindful of the weather and its possible impacts and to ensure goods vehicles are prepared for that impact. In the most recent adverse weather spell in Britain, we saw the UK Met Office deploy its multi-tier weather alert status, issuing either a yellow, amber or red alert depending on both the likelihood and potential impact of severe weather conditions, covering rain, snow, high winds, fog and ice.Īdvice for road haulage drivers in the event of Met Office weather warnings highlight the relative severity of the different levels of alert. ![]() According to the Freight Trade Association, jack-knifing lorries are one of the primary causes of motorway closures nationwide. Road haulageĮxtreme weather – and in particular heavy snowfall and icy conditions – can cause serious disruption to road traffic. According to a UK government report from the House of Commons Transport Committee, severe weather in the winter of 2010 – which closed Heathrow Airport entirely for a three-day period, as well as significantly affecting road and rail transport – reduced the UK’s GDP by a total of 0.5%, and cost the national economy around £280 million per day. ![]() ![]() But it can be easy to underestimate exactly what scale this impact can have. It goes without saying that adverse weather conditions can affect the flow of goods, both nationally and internationally. How do adverse weather conditions affect shipping?
